Missouri University of Science and Technology vs Saint Louis University

Missouri University of Science and Technology is a public university in Rolla, MO, and Saint Louis University is a private university in Saint Louis, MO. Missouri University of Science and Technology is the more selective of the two, admitting about 73% of applicants against 75% at Saint Louis University. Missouri University of Science and Technology is the cheaper of the two after aid, averaging about $16,298 a year against $24,398 at Saint Louis University. About 80% of students graduate at Saint Louis University, compared with 64% at Missouri University of Science and Technology. Ten years after enrolling, Missouri University of Science and Technology alumni earn a median of about $82,957, against $70,783 for Saint Louis University.

What is the full cost of attendance at Missouri University of Science and Technology and Saint Louis University?
Before aid, Missouri University of Science and Technology costs about $29,231 a year and Saint Louis University about $71,932. That is the sticker price; most students pay less once grants and scholarships are applied.
Which is cheaper for a family earning under $30,000, Missouri University of Science and Technology or Saint Louis University?
Missouri University of Science and Technology. Families earning under $30,000 a year pay about $10,912 there, against about $22,501 at Saint Louis University. Aid is income-tested, so this can differ from the average price and from the sticker price.
Which is bigger, Missouri University of Science and Technology or Saint Louis University?
Saint Louis University is the larger of the two, with about 7,267 undergraduates against 5,521 at Missouri University of Science and Technology.
Does Missouri University of Science and Technology or Saint Louis University have a better graduation rate?
Saint Louis University has the higher graduation rate, at about 80% against 64% at Missouri University of Science and Technology.
Do graduates of Missouri University of Science and Technology or Saint Louis University earn more?
Missouri University of Science and Technology alumni earn more on average: a median of about $82,957 ten years after enrolling, against about $70,783 for Saint Louis University. Earnings vary far more by major than by school.
